UPVC, also known by Unplasticised Polyvinyl chloride (or UPVC), is a sturdy material that requires minimal maintenance. It's a great choice to make window frames doors, and siding. You can even combine it with double-glazed panes of glass.

UPVC is extremely durable and will not fade or rot. It is also resistant against corrosion and external noise. It does require some maintenance to stay in top shape.

You must maintain your uPVC windows on a regular basis to ensure their longevity. You can clean the frame and any parts with soapy water. After cleaning them, dry them with a dry, clean, dry cloth.

Avoid using ammonia-based cleansers when cleaning your UPVC windows. These chemicals can harm the metal parts of the windows.

Longevity

If you're thinking of replacing your windows, be aware of the lifespan of UPVC windows. With proper care they can last for up to 40 years. This means they're also affordable and energy efficient. They will save you money on your energy bills and will keep your home warm during winter.

There are many elements that can affect the durability of uPVC windows. The quality of the material used in manufacturing them is among the most important. Materials of poor quality can dramatically decrease the lifespan of uPVC windows.

There are numerous things you can do to will prolong their life. It is important to clean them frequently. This will stop dirt from clogging the frame. To clean them it is recommended to use a non-abrasive towel.

Another thing to keep in mind is the kind of glass you pick. You can purchase uPVC windows that are double-glazed, meaning that they have two layers of glass that are joined by a polymer mixture. This will make your uPVC windows more durable and resistant to cracking.

You must also take into consideration the quality of the installation. A well-designed installation will prolong the life of your UPVC windows. It is recommended to hire a professional company to do the job.

The life expectancy of uPVC windows is determined by the quality of the material as well as the quality of the installation, and the environment in which the windows are set up. These factors can assist you in choosing the ideal uPVC window for your home.
